0
$0.00
0

The fresh new Cave Drakensberg Resort & Spa, Bergville

The fresh new Cave Drakensberg Resort & Spa, Bergville Regarding bonding toward blokes, a periodic take in after finishing up work or an instant games out-of squash anywhere between group meetings sometimes doesn’t frequently cut it. What you would like try an enthusiastic adrenaline-filled sunday close to your very best mates, from your gruelling day …

Continue Reading
X